Welcome aboard! One thing everyone asks about in week one: the hardware lab. It's on level two of the Ashgrove Building, behind the double doors past the kitchenette. You can use it anytime once you've done the short safety briefing with the lab steward — just grab a slot from the team calendar. After the briefing, you're free to come and go. The door code is below.

door code, yagap-bahof: bdg-O-05

### Queue-Depth Autoscaler — Quick Checks

If Pelicart's ingest queue climbs past 10k, the autoscaler should add workers within two minutes. If it doesn't, check that the depth metric is actually publishing — silence reads as zero, which is the classic trap. Before filing anything, grab the scaler's current build so we're all staring at the same thing.

pipeline stamp: htk31_f769b577b3028a4e9958e5bb8d1259a

## Who to ping about GiftNote

Welcome aboard! GiftNote is our donation-receipt mailer for the Larchfield Fund. Template tweaks go to the comms folks; delivery failures and bounce weirdness go to the platform crew. Don't push template changes on Fridays — receipts batch over the weekend. For anything GiftNote-related, start with the address below.

billing contact of kaweg-tajeg = drudor.lamion.oliath@torvalabs.test

Load tests against the Pellworth checkout flow run through the Gantry harness, which replays anonymized order traffic at configurable multiples of peak. New team members should target the staging cluster in the Hollis region only; production endpoints reject the load-test header outright. Ramp profiles live in the harness config repo, and results post automatically to the Gantry dashboard after each run. Before starting a run, the harness must authenticate to the internal metering service using the key provided below.

service key, fawip-bajef: kto11_Qt5wZK9vdNC